What You'll Learn & Design:
- 🤖 Cartesian 3-Axis Robot: Understand the mechanics behind this versatile robot.
- 👐 Pick & Place Machine: Learn to design systems that handle delicate components with precision.
- ⚙️ Single-Axis Linear Motion: Discover the principles of linear actuators and motion control.
- 🎫 Distribution/Accumulation Turntable: Design turntables that are a staple in many production lines.
- 🔄 Single-Axis Piston Rejection Mechanisms: Create mechanisms for efficiently sorting or rejecting products.
- 🅿️ Flat Conveyor Belts: Learn to design flat conveyors for transporting items on an assembly line.
- 🛠️ Modular Conveyor Belts: Design flexible and adaptable conveyor systems.
- 👩🏫 Fusion 360 Functions Introduction: Get to grips with all the necessary functions of Fusion 360 to become proficient in the software.
